reference, declarationdefinition
definition → references, declarations, derived classes, virtual overrides
reference to multiple definitions → definitions
unreferenced

References

tools/clang/tools/libclang/CIndex.cpp
 4651   if (clang_Cursor_isNull(C))
 4654   ASTContext &Ctx = getCursorContext(C);
 4656   if (clang_isStatement(C.kind)) {
 4657     const Stmt *S = getCursorStmt(C);
 4667   if (C.kind == CXCursor_ObjCMessageExpr) {
 4669           ME = dyn_cast_or_null<ObjCMessageExpr>(getCursorExpr(C))) {
 4676   if (C.kind == CXCursor_ObjCInstanceMethodDecl ||
 4677       C.kind == CXCursor_ObjCClassMethodDecl) {
 4679           MD = dyn_cast_or_null<ObjCMethodDecl>(getCursorDecl(C))) {
 4686   if (C.kind == CXCursor_ObjCCategoryDecl ||
 4687       C.kind == CXCursor_ObjCCategoryImplDecl) {
 4691           CD = dyn_cast_or_null<ObjCCategoryDecl>(getCursorDecl(C)))
 4694           CID = dyn_cast_or_null<ObjCCategoryImplDecl>(getCursorDecl(C)))
 4698   if (C.kind == CXCursor_ModuleImportDecl) {
 4702             dyn_cast_or_null<ImportDecl>(getCursorDecl(C))) {
 4711   if (C.kind == CXCursor_CXXMethod || C.kind == CXCursor_Destructor ||
 4711   if (C.kind == CXCursor_CXXMethod || C.kind == CXCursor_Destructor ||
 4712       C.kind == CXCursor_ConversionFunction ||
 4713       C.kind == CXCursor_FunctionDecl) {
 4717             dyn_cast_or_null<FunctionDecl>(getCursorDecl(C))) {
 4738   CXSourceLocation CXLoc = clang_getCursorLocation(C);